First responders need support as new generation of automobiles emerges | GERALD ALLEN
As EVs and charging stations become more common in Alabama and across the nation, there is a need for first responders to be better equipped and prepared to respond to emergencies involving EVs and, more specifically, lithium-ion batteries. The Alabama Fire College is working to ensure that first and second responders in Alabama are trained on how to properly deal with battery-related emergencies.

What is Patrick Murphy's NCAA Softball Tournament record? Alabama softball coach in 25th postseason
Patrick Murphy is not just one of the more prominent head coaching figures in college softball, but also one of the winningest coaches in the sport. Murphy, who is in his 25th season associated with the Alabama softball program, ranks 15th among all Division I college softball coaches — and fifth among active coaches — at 1,263 career wins.
